Default SBE II or Xtrema2?

Looking for any of you guys out there that have the Beretta Xtrema2 or the Benelli Super Black Eagle II. I'm interested to know what you think of your autoloader. Will be purchasing one of these and am hoping for some good input. Thanks.

Default RE: SBE II or Xtrema2?

Either isvery good choices. Both models have some improvements over their first models. The SBE II has bigger trigger gaurd and a better action/recoil spring assembly. It should drain better and be quite a bit easier to take apart. The Xtrema II is a tad bit lighter even though it's listed the same as the Xtrema. The forearm has deeper grooves which makes it feel a little thinner. The stock is also thinner in the wrist area. It still has that wide grip.
I'mnot sure how much the KickOff system on the Beretta works as I have not shot the Xtrema II. I have shot the SBE II next to a SBE with various loads.The ComforTech does not offer any reduction in felt recoil. The removeable comb is soft and could help some with face slap. Thereis a taller one that can be inserted. It's a nice feature and the next best thingto an adjustable one.
Both guns have automatic magazine cutoff's. The Beretta has a bolt lock back lever that the SBE II does not. Both come with shims to adjust to stock for drop and cast. They have a similar balance with more weight towards the stock. The SBE II is a little lighter. The Xtrema will more than likely cycle lighter shells better. The Xtrema II is easy to clean with the SBE II being even easier. If you include cleaning the action/recoil spring and tube the Xtrema will be easier. The Beretta holds five shells to the SBE II's four (Non waterfowling).You need to hold each to see which you like the best. I would suggest to also look at the Browning Gold 3 1/2" model it's equally good.

Default RE: SBE II or Xtrema2?

I would get the SBE II, I like it 10 times better than the Extreama. The comfort tec stock reduces recoil a lot and the grips are slimmer. The extreama feels like you are holding a club not a shotgun. The SBE II action also feels smoother to me and it has the larger trigger guard for gloves. Right now I am using a Nova, but when I can aford it I will be upgrading to a SBE II.
